Caros,
Estou configurando o samba para ser usado como um NT PDC, mas estou
enfrentando problemas. Abaixo detalhos meus passos:
Depois de diversas leituras (historico de listas, smb manual, faqs) vi que é
possivel o samba agir omo NT Primary Domain Control. Isto signiica que
clientes Win9x e NT podem usar um servidor Linux para se autenticarem e
compartilhar arquivos. Isto pode ser implementado a partir do samba-2.0.x.
Pois bem...eis abaixo meu smb.conf.
# Samba config file created using SWAT
# from localhost (127.0.0.1)
# Date: 2001/03/23 11:09:20
# Global parameters
[global]
workgroup = PMAP
server string = Samba Server
passwd program = /usr/bin/passwd
password level = 8
unix password sync = Yes
log file = /var/log/samba/log.%m
max log size = 50
socket options = TCP_NODELAY SO_RCVBUF=8192 SO_SNDBUF=8192
domain logons = Yes
preferred master = Yes
domain master = Yes
dns proxy = No
wins support = Yes
[homes]
comment = Home Directories
path = /home
writeable = Yes
browseable = No
[printers]
comment = All Printers
path = /var/spool/samba
printable = Yes
browseable = No
NOTA: tomei o cuidado de desabilitar a encriptacao de senha, tanto no samba
como nos clientes.
Adicionando conta para as maquinas:
adicionei manualmente em /etc/passwd e /etc/shadow
cliente_02$:x:56:230:Welk:/dev/null:/
cliente_03$:x:57:230:Hendrix:/dev/null:/
cliente_02$:NP:6445::::::
cliente_03$:NP:6445::::::
Logo em seguida, criei os usuários com o smbpasswd:
#smbpasswd -a -m cliente_02
#smbpasswd -a -m cliente_03
Adicionei tambem contas para users normais terem acesso.
Pm01
Pm02
etc...
CLIENTES:
desabilitei a encriptacao de senha, configurei os ips, e nomes...
habilietei no ambiente de rede para usar um dominio NT e especifiquei o IP
do samba server
PROBLEMAS:
-Ao fazer o logon em um cliente win, nao vejo problemas, e faço o login
normalmente. o abrir o ambiente de rede, enchergo o server, entro e vejo o
diretorio home compartilhado nele...mas quando vou tentar abrir um outro
cliente win...obtenho a msg:
Não há servidores de Logon disponíveis para iniciar a requisição.
-Durante uma tentativa de compartilhar um diretorio de um cliente win, na
janela de compartilhamento tenho a opcao de listar os possiveis users a
terem acessos. quando tento adicionar, obtenho o erro:
A lista de usuarios nao esta disponivel no momento. Tente mais tarde.
- Finalmente, olhando os logs do Linux vejo a seguinte msg sempre que um
cliente win faz o logon:
Mar 23 12:45:17 server PAM_pwdb[2762]: authentication failure; (uid=0) ->
Pm02 for samba service
Pelo que andei lendo, parece que ha um problema na hora de o cliente guardar
sua senha. Ele guarda toda em maiuscula mas o smb conversa com o PAM q nao
consegue autenticar devido a isso.
Notem que coloquei o parametro:
password level = 8
no samba, de modo que ele tente varias combinacoes da senha em Uper ou
Lower...mas mesmo assim nao obtive sucesso..
Retirei parte das informacoes para exeutar esta config em:
http://socrates.mps.ohio-state.edu/~ccunning/samba.html
Gostaria de comentarios e sugestoes a respeito dos problemas mencionados...
[]´s
--
Rodrigo R. Morais ([EMAIL PROTECTED])
Linux Registered User # 167159
DTL Solucoes & Tecnologia
http://www.dtlnet.com.br
Assinantes em 23/03/2001: 2190
Mensagens recebidas desde 07/01/1999: 106449
Historico e [des]cadastramento: http://linux-br.conectiva.com.br
Assuntos administrativos e problemas com a lista:
mailto:[EMAIL PROTECTED]